Donington Park Circuit, Castle Donington, Derby UK to host British Formula 1 Grand Prix - 2010 until 2026

doningtongrandprixcitiesFurther my blog rumour report of almost a year ago, Happy Camping - Donington Park wins British F1 GP 2010, today, just a week before the FINAL GP at Silverstone Circuit, it was officially announced that Donington Park Circuit in Derby UK has secured a contract to host the the great race for a 17 year period begining 2010.
